Using Shock Tube to Investigate Supersonic Gas Solid Two Phase Flow
Shi Honghui

(State Key Laboratory of Nonlinear Mechanics, Institute of Mechanics, Chinese Academy of Sciences, Beijing 100080, China)

   

Abstract: The compressible gas solid two phase flow is investigated in a shock tube. The shock attenuation caused by solid particles is measured. The shock in teraction with the particles is visualized using the schlieren photography. Different structures of particles are tested. It is found that the non linear aerodynamics is a key factor.
